Como pegar o último registro de uma tabela no banco de dados mySQL ?

Publicado 19/11/2017 19:58:46

Como pegar o último registro de uma tabela no banco de dados mySQL ?
Existem duas formas de retornar o último registro de uma tabela no banco de dados mySQL. Pelo maior valor da chave primária da tabela ou campo ID, por exemplo: SELECT MAX(ID) FROM tabela Onde a variável ID é a chave primária e tabela é o nome de sua tabela. Por ordem decrescente de seleção, por exemplo: SELECT ID FROM tabela ORDER BY ID DESC LIMIT 1 Onde a variável ID é a chave primária e tabela é o nome de sua tabela. Pelo último registro adicionado do comando INSERT, por exemplo: INSERT INTO tabela (nome) VALUES ($nome) SELECT LAST_INSERT_ID() Os comandos devem ser executados juntos, caso contrário LAST_INSERT_ID retornará 0 como resultado.

Sobre Mim

Integer augue nisl, pharetra ut dapibus at, hendrerit id dui. Nunc hendrerit iaculis tortor ac tincidunt. Pellentesque quis placerat neque, eget consequat ligula. Integer in urna viverra, luctus magna id, sagittis erat. Praesent turpis ipsum, varius in est quis, dapibus vehicula sem. Donec imperdiet pellentesque neque, sit amet accumsan odio ultrices ut.

Ads

Modelo